What is Machine Learning?
Machine learning (ML) refers to the use of algorithms and statistical models to enable computers to perform specific tasks without explicit instructions, relying instead on patterns and inference.
Applications of Machine Learning
Machine learning has a wide range of applications across various fields, including:
- Healthcare – Predictive analytics for patient care
- Finance – Fraud detection and risk management
- Marketing – Customer segmentation and targeting
- Automation – Enhancing operational efficiency

Key Concepts in Machine Learning
Here are some essential concepts you should be familiar with:
| Term | Description |
|---|---|
| Supervised Learning | A type of ML where the model is trained on labeled data. |
| Unsupervised Learning | A type of ML that deals with unlabeled data to find patterns. |
| Reinforcement Learning | A type of ML where an agent learns to make decisions by receiving rewards or penalties. |

FAQs about Machine Learning
What are the prerequisites for learning machine learning?
Basic knowledge of programming (especially Python), statistics, and linear algebra is beneficial.
Is machine learning the same as artificial intelligence?
Machine learning is a subset of artificial intelligence focused on enabling machines to learn from data.
What industries benefit from machine learning?
Nearly every industry can benefit from machine learning, including healthcare, finance, marketing, and more.
